Discomfort after being catheterized can vary from person to person, but it typically lasts a few hours to a couple of days. Some individuals may experience mild irritation or a burning sensation during urination, which usually resolves as the urinary tract adjusts. If discomfort persists or worsens, it is important to consult a healthcare provider, as it could indicate an infection or other complications.
